My own experimental shoots (DSLR & Mobile) DSLR: Holy Grail This time-lapse was shot with a shutter speed of 1/400's at f7.1 with the ISO at 400. I left the camera shooting at an interval of 3 seconds for about 40 minutes with 468 images having been shot. I imported all the images into Lightroom classic cc and used the sync button in order to allow for all changes that I make to one image, to be applied to all the images that Imported into the catalog. I started editing all of the images by increasing the c ontrast to +44 which increased the contrast between the blue sky and the different clouds that can be seen.  I then upped the s hadows to +75. This brightened the trees in the foreground so you can see the details a lot more clearly such as the flowers and leaves on the trees. Next, I increased the c larity to +15. Time-lapse 1 (Week 2) This time-lapse was shot with a shutter speed of 1/500's at f11 with the ISO at 100.  I left the camera shooting at an interval of 3 seconds for about 40 minutes with 751 images having been shot. I imported all the images into Lightroom classic cc and used the sync button in order to allow for all changes that I make to one image, to be applied to all the images that Imported into the catalog. I started editing all the images by, increasing the contrast to +22 to really make the clouds stand out. I then decreased the shadows to -65 to lighten the areas of the images that had too much shadow. I increased the whites slightly to +33 which brightened parts of the images. I lowered the blacks to -13 in order to lighten some areas which I thought were too dark.
